MEETING OF CREDITORS.
.ESTATE OF. EDMUND. REDDISH. .' • -The'..adjourned, meeting of creditors in ; the bankrupt" estato of Edmund Keddish, cycle agent,- Lower Hutt,-. was held, .at .the. Official Assignee's office yesterday afterncioiiy Mr.' A. Simpson presiding. Mr. Wilford appeared for the .haukrupt, while jrr. Ayson represented tho interests of the petitioning creditors (Peton'o "Chronicle" C'Dinpany, Bradley and t'o., aiid T. Burt). The previous meeting was adjourned from August '26 in order, to allow of a more detailed statement of the bankrupt's affairs being submitted. It'.'now appears that thn bankrupt's liabilities total ■£&!& 3s. 4d— .businessdebts,£lß9'!s.ld.; private debts, .£122 9s, 3d.; owing on- furniture, £38 10s. Tho Official Assignee explained that the bankrupt had no offer to inako to his creditors. ll® was out. of work, had a wife and three children to support, anil no- prospects. Tho bankrupt was examined by ono of his principal creditors with reference to certain facts .in connection with' hia financial affairs,- and the proceedings wore then adjourned, sine die.
